The Midland Parallel Bar Glider, available through Warrenville, Ill-based company Patterson Medical, is built to be ideal for patients who require more assistance and support when practicing functional ambulation skills. The product is positioned on parallel bars, according to the company’s website, and is designed to provide assistance to patients with hemiplegia, extremity or trunk weakness, balance issues, or those who cannot bear weight on the wrists or hands.

The site notes that patients are supported and bear weight on padded forearm platforms that adjust laterally from 9 inches to 22 inches. The glider is engineered to adjust easily without tools and fits fixed- and adjustable-width parallel bars with widths from 15 inches to 28 inches.

Its maximum user weight capacity is 300 pounds.
